Tunisia: March 18 Declaration of the UGTT

Posted on March 24, 2011 at 18:42 0 Comments

"Put an End to the Policies of Indebtedness,

Against Foreign Interference in Libya"

By MOHAMED BEN LARBI

TUNIS -- The mass mobilizations of the people across Tunisia, mainly the gigantic demonstrations in Tunis (over 500,000) and Sfax, forced the M'bazaa-Caïd-Essebsi government to announce that elections for the ConstituentAssembly will be held on July 24, 2011.



For the Great Powers, everything must be done to maintain a regime that ensures the implementation of the…

The Battle of Wisconsin: What Next?

Posted on March 16, 2011 at 18:26 1 Comment

By ALAN BENJAMIN

 

An editorial in the March 12-13, 2011, issue of the International Herald Tribune summarized a wing of the U.S. ruling class’s assessment of the new situation facing the labor-student resistance movement in Wisconsin in the aftermath of the Republicans’ late-hour putsch to strip unions of their collective-bargaining rights. It read, in part:

 

“The unions have lost the battle for their rights. … The outcome was probably inevitable given the Republican success… Continue
